Janice Tjen enters the Nottingham Open first-round matchup on grass holding recent head-to-head momentum, having defeated Leylah Fernandez in straight sets at the 2026 Dubai WTA 1000 and again in the Australian Open first round. The Indonesian, who reached a career-high ranking of No. 36 earlier in the year, has shown improved consistency on faster surfaces despite a mixed 2026 win-loss record. Fernandez, the No. 2 seed and established top-30 player, brings superior experience and power but has faced questions about form after early exits in prior grass events. Key variables include Tjen’s aggressive baseline game suiting the low-bouncing courts, any fatigue from recent scheduling, and Fernandez’s ability to adjust tactics against a player who has exploited her movement in prior encounters.
